How much do data science instructor j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for data science instructor in Virginia is $58,211.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$42,100.00 and $66,400.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a data science instructor?

A Data Science Instructor is responsible for teaching data science concepts, tools, and techniques to students or professionals. They design curriculum, develop learning materials, and provide hands-on training in areas such as machine learning, statistical analysis, and data visualization. Instructors may work for universities, bootcamps, or online platforms, and they often guide students with real-world projects and practical applications. Strong communication skills and industry experience are essential for effectively conveying complex topics.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a data science instructor?

To thrive as a Data Science Instructor, you need a strong background in data science concepts, programming (often Python or R), machine learning, and statistical analysis, typically backed by a relevant degree or industry experience. Familiarity with tools such as Jupyter Notebooks, Tableau, and Git, as well as certifications like Google Data Analytics or AWS Certified Data Analytics, is highly valued. Excellent communication, mentorship, and presentation skills help make complex topics accessible and engaging. These skills ensure instructors can effectively convey up-to-date industry knowledge, support diverse learners, and foster strong educational outcomes.

What are the main challenges faced by data science instructors and how can they be addressed?

Data Science Instructors often encounter challenges such as keeping up with rapidly evolving technologies and catering to students with varying skill levels. Staying current requires ongoing professional development and participation in industry forums or training. To address different learning paces, successful instructors design a range of assignments and provide individualized feedback. Collaborating with other instructors and participating in curriculum development also helps create a supportive teaching environment and enhances student success.

Job description

Swift is a privately held, mission-driven and employee-focused services and solutions company headquartered in Reston, VA. Our capabilities include Software Development, Engineering & IT, Data Science, Cyber Enablement, Logistics, and Training. Founded in 2019, Swift supports Civilian, Defense, and Intelligence Community customers across the country and around the globe. Swift is looking for a Ubiquitous Technical Surveillance (UTS) Instructorto support the delivery, development, and continuous improvement of UTS training programs. This is a part-time, 1099 contractor position requiring an individual with practical UTS knowledge and experience who can translate complex technical and operational concepts into effective, engaging instruction. The instructor will deliver classroom, hands-on, and scenario-based training while also contributing to the ongoing design, development, and refinement of UTS course materials, practical exercises, scenarios, and instructional content. An active security clearance is preferred but not required. Prior UTS experience and demonstrated experience delivering technical or operational training are essential. Responsibilities: * Deliver instructor-led UTS training to students with varying levels of technical and operational experience. * Provide classroom, practical, and scenario-based instruction covering UTS concepts, technologies, methodologies, and operational considerations. * Translate complex technical and operational concepts into clear, practical instruction applicable to real-world environments. * Facilitate hands-on exercises, demonstrations, and practical training scenarios. * Assist with the design, development, and continuous improvement of UTS curriculum and training programs. * Develop and update course materials, including presentations, instructor guides, student materials, practical exercises, scenarios, assessments, and supporting documentation. * Incorporate emerging technologies, evolving surveillance capabilities, and relevant operational lessons into training content. * Evaluate student understanding and performance through practical exercises, knowledge assessments, and instructor observation. * Gather student and instructor feedback and incorporate lessons learned into future course development. * Collaborate with technical subject matter experts, instructional designers, program leadership, and other instructors to ensure training remains operationally relevant and technically accurate. * Maintain familiarity with emerging technologies and trends affecting ubiquitous technical surveillance environments. * Support training demonstrations, equipment preparation, classroom setup, and other activities necessary for successful course delivery. Requirements: * Demonstrated professional experience with Ubiquitous Technical Surveillance (UTS) concepts, technologies, environments, or related operational disciplines. * Prior experience delivering technical, intelligence, operational, or mission-focused training. * Ability to confidently instruct both technical and non-technical audiences. * Strong presentation, communication, and facilitation skills. * Experience conducting hands-on or scenario-based instruction. * Ability to translate complex technical information into understandable and actionable training. * Experience developing, updating, or contributing to training curriculum and instructional materials. * Ability to work collaboratively with technical SMEs and instructional development teams. * Strong organizational skills and attention to detail. * Ability to adapt training delivery based on student experience, course objectives, and evolving technologies. Desired Experience: * Previous experience within the U.S. Intelligence Community (IC), Department of War (DoW), U.S. military, or related national security environment. * IC and/or DoW instructional experience, including experience supporting intelligence, surveillance, counterintelligence, technical operations, or related operational disciplines. * Experience developing and delivering training within intelligence or national security environments, not limited to traditional military instructional roles. * Experience developing scenario-based or experiential training programs. * Familiarity with adult learning principles and instructional design methodologies. * Experience with emerging technologies relevant to surveillance, digital environments, data collection, sensors, communications, or related technical disciplines. * Prior experience serving as a technical instructor, operational trainer, intelligence instructor, or subject matter expert.
